Subject: howto see shmem
Date: Wed, 24 Oct 2001 18:40:16 -0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20011024214017.E5B1D2AB49@bugs.unl.edu.ar> (raw)
I have found out that /proc/meminfo doesn't have (at least that's my first
thought) info about shared memory (it shows 0, even in heavy duty servers).
ipcs also shows nothing, so how can I see the amount of shared memory being
used?
Th mounted /dev/shmem device also shows 0 kb used (just in case).
